This is a distinctive, well proportioned, detached bungalow located in the popular district of Craiglockhart. Providing flexible family accommodation, this is a rare opportunity, as it is set back in a large corner garden plot and, subject to obtaining relevant consents, also provides great development potential.

The accommodation comprises: entrance vestibule; L-shaped hall; well-proportioned living room with doors leading to the bright and sunny conservatory; family-room/ bedroom with bay window facing the front of the property; 3 double bedrooms overlooking the rear garden; kitchen/breakfast room benefitting from wall/ base units with ample worktop area; and bathroom with 3 white fittings and a shower fitted over the bath.

The extensive garden grounds to the front, sides and rear of the property are made up of a combination of lawn and beds with a wide variety of shrubs, plants and mature trees.

There is a single attached garage accessed by way of a driveway, providing additional off- street parking. There is a further gravel driveway/parking area suitable for several vehicles.

Features include: gas central heating, double glazing, extensive garden, single detached garage, additional drive and development potential. AREA

Located in the Craiglockhart district, and approximately four miles to the south of Edinburgh’s city centre, all the main facilities are reasonably accessible.

The immediate area is well served by an excellent selection of local shops, a 24-hour Tesco, as well as an Asda, Lidl, and M&S Food at which is only a few minutes drive away. The neighbouring Morningside and , have a range of specialist shops, banking and postal services, bars and restaurants.

The wide range of leisure facilities in the area include Craiglockhart Sports and Tennis Centre, Hillend Ski Centre, theatres, cinemas, golf courses, and the Union Canal walkway. The wide expanses of the Craiglockhart, Blackford, Braid and Pentland Hills are close at hand, as is the Fountainpark Multicomplex, where there is a Nuffield Health Gym.

Schooling is well represented from nursery to senior level, both in the public and private sectors including High, George Watsons College and Castle School.

In addition, the property is well situated for the City’s business and commerce centres at Lothian Road and as well as Napier University, Edinburgh College of Art, and Edinburgh University.

For the commuter, regular bus services take you to the City Centre and surrounding areas. For those travelling further afield, the City Bypass is within easy driving distance and provides access to the main motorway networks, Edinburgh Airport and the new Queensferry Crossing, whilst Waverley and Haymarket railway stations are also nearby.
